Statute of Limitations
The statute of limitations is a period that victims and their family members must meet in order to file a legal claim. The timeframes vary based on the state of the victim and the type of claim filed and whether it is an injury-related or wrongful death case. Additionally, some victims may qualify for an extension of the statute of limitations or other exemptions in certain situations. A mesothelioma lawyer will help asbestos victims as well as their families and loved ones understand the deadlines they have and the best method to take action to pursue their claims.
The statute of limitations starts to run when a person is diagnosed with mesothelioma. However, the time frame to start a mesothelioma lawsuit begins when the victim ought to have realized that their condition was caused by asbestos exposure. Damages
Mesothelioma victims can claim compensation for the many costs resulting from their asbestos exposure. These include medical bills, lost wages and other financial losses. In addition, victims can receive compensation for pain and suffering. Compensation can also help families pay for funeral costs, caregiving and other expenses.

Once your lawyer has collected all the required information, they will file a lawsuit for mesothelioma. The defendants are provided with a copy of the lawsuit and have 30 days to respond. During this time, attorneys from both sides will exchange discovery documents and conduct witness testimonies (depositions).
Certain mesothelioma cases will come to an agreement to settle the case prior to the trial date. This is advantageous for the patient as they will receive a set amount of money immediately and avoid the uncertainty of a verdict at trial. A trial could be required if defendants refuse to settle for a fair amount.

Mesothelioma suits are typically filed as personal injury lawsuits however, wrongful-death lawsuits can be filed on behalf of a family member of a victim. The wrongful death lawsuits claim asbestos exposure caused your loved one to die. Most mesothelioma cases that result in wrongful death are settled privately with the lawyers of the defendants prior to the verdict is made. In the past, some cases were handled as a class lawsuit, but nowadays the majority of them are handled separately. If your mesothelioma lawsuit is part of a multidistrict litigation (MDL) your case could be consolidated with similar suits.
